It’s Texas Mushroom Conference weekend and we are ready to sprinkle spores on everyone. We are partnering up with Austin Beerworks at their new location at Sprinkle Valley. Come explore the diverse, nocturnal ecosystem of new 64 acre property with UV flashlights and cameras to look for mushrooms, night pollinators, birds, glowing plants, lichens and more. Learn how fungi is entangled in the forest helping plants gain water and nutrients, creating the pigments that give flowers their beautiful colors, to helping plants communicate with pollinators. Guests will learn how to look for, photograph and be community scientists in adding fluorescing organisms to the iNaturalist project
